Overview:

Since the financial crisis, JPMorgan Chase & Co. (JPM, Financial) has become the largest U.S. bank, surpassing Wells Fargo & Co. (WFC, Financial). This is thanks to the outstanding leadership of Jamie Dimon and his team of executives.

Since the crisis, the New York-based bank has expanded its earnings and grown its loan and deposit base while maintaining healthy margins and returning billions to shareholders.

Dimon was in London when he sat down with CNBC. In the interview, he discussed how Brexit will affect London as the financial capital. He also touched on the effects of the Hong Kong protests and the trade dispute between the U.S. and China. He said he is in favor of the Federal Reserve's three rate cuts as he sees them as a good thing for the economy.
